A Powertrain Built for Both Worlds
Under the hood, the 2026 Lexus GX runs a 3.4-liter twin-turbocharged V6 producing 349 horsepower and 479 lb.-ft. of torque. That torque figure tells the whole story — it arrives early in the rev range, between 2,000 and 3,600 rpm, which means confident acceleration whether you’re merging onto the highway or crawling up a rocky incline. Towing capacity reaches up to 9,096 lbs (when properly equipped) on the Overtrail trim, making this a capable hauler as well.
Off-Road DNA, Refined
The GX doesn’t fake its off-road credentials. A Torsen® limited-slip center locking differential comes standard across all trims. The Overtrail and Overtrail+ add an electronic locking rear differential, Crawl Control, Multi-Terrain Select, and Electronic Kinetic Dynamic Suspension System (E-KDSS) for serious trail work. Ground clearance reaches up to 9.84 inches on the Overtrail, with a wading depth of 27.56 inches across the lineup.
Luxury That Doesn’t Compromise
Step inside, and the ruggedness disappears entirely. Heated and ventilated front seats, front massaging seats, a 14-inch Lexus Interface™ touchscreen, and Thematic Ambient Illumination define the upper trims. The available Mark Levinson® 21-speaker premium surround sound system rounds out an interior that feels as refined as any Lexus sedan.
